JUSTICE HEMANT KUMAR SRIVASTAVA ORAL ORDER 26-03-2015 Heard learned counsel for the petitioner and learned Additional Public Prosecutor for the State as also heard learned counsel for the complainant.
The petitioner apprehends his arrest in connection with Complaint Case No. 1277 of 2014, in which, cognizance has been taken for the offence punishable under Section-498A, 406, 504 of the Indian Penal Code Sections-498(A), 323, 324, 379, 149 of the Indian Penal Code and Section-3/4 of Dowry Prohibition Act.
The petitioner happens to be husband of the complainant and it is an admitted position that earlier, the marriage of the complainant had taken place with elder brother of the petitioner and after his death, the petitioner solemnized his marriage with the complainant but later on, differences cropped up
Patna High Court Cr.Misc. No.11646 of 2015 (2) dt.26-03-2015 2/3 between them, resulting filing of the present case. However, in course of hearing, both parties submit that they are ready to lead their conjugal life.
In view of the aforesaid submissions, without entering into merit of the case, this petition stands disposed off with direction to the petitioner to surrender before Sri R. K. Pandey, learned Judicial Magistrate-Ist Class/concerned court, Gopalganj and seek regular bail within four weeks from the date of receipt/production of copy of this order and if, the petitioner does so, the petitioner shall be enlarged on provisional bail on the date of surrender itself, for a period of four months on furnishing bail bond of Rs 10,000/-(ten thousand) with two sureties of the like amount each to the satisfaction of Sri R. K. Pandey, learned Judicial Magistrate-Ist Class/concerned court, Gopalganj in connection with Complaint Case No. 1277 of 2014.
It is further made clear that after being released on provisional bail, the concerned court shall issue notice to the petitioner as well as the complainant, fixing a date for reconciliation and shall take all efforts to patch up the dispute of the parties within four months from the date of surrender of the petitioner.
